Resumen:
A simple approach is described for the separation and determination of inorganic arsenic species using solid phase extraction and electrothermal atomic absorption spectrometry (ETAAS). A Dowex 2x10 anion exchange mini-column was used to separate As(III) and As(V). The chemical (pH, type and concentration of eluent) and physical (flow rate of sample and eluent) parameters affecting the separation were studied. Under optimized conditions, As(V) showed a strong affinity for the mini-column, while As(III) was collected in the effluent. As(V) was recovered by elution with 0.8 mol L-1 hydrochloric acid. The influence of different culture media on the separation of As(III) and As(V) was also evaluated. Inorganic species of As were detected in the free-cells supernatants from growth culture of bacteria isolates from drinking water wells of Tucumán province, with high levels contents of arsenic.
